About the Contest

Jamglue is excited to bring you a remix contest featuring "Driving Down The Block" by Duck Down and Major League recording artist Kidz In The Hall. Here's how you can participate:

  1. Enter the contest by creating your own copy of the official contest mix. The easiest way to do this is to click the "Start Mixing Now!" button and then "SAVE A COPY" in the Mixer to create your own version of the song.
  2. Remix the song by adding new sounds, rearranging the clips, etc. using the Jamglue Mixer. You can even add your own voice using the Jamglue Recorder in the Mixer. Be creative, and don't forget to publish your mix when you're done so that people can vote for it!
  3. Promote your mix - embed it in your MySpace and email a link to all of your friends. The "Popular Vote" winning mixes are determined by how many people mark them as a Favorite, so break out your address book and encourage your friends to vote for yours!
  4. Win great prizes!

The Deadlines

  • Publish your contest entry by August 17, 2008
  • Vote for your favorite contest entries by August 31, 2008

About Kidz in the Hall

For the latest updates and news on all the Duck Down artists, log on to DuckDown.com!

The sons of the Golden Era of Hip Hop now take the reins at the forefront of the next great Hip Hop dynasty. Call 'em elitists, call 'em smart asses or arrogant, but they are definitely one thing for certain, DOPE.

Co-signed by Just Blaze, 3H (50 cent, Kanye West), and Matty C (Originator of Unsigned Hype), the Kidz music speaks volumes. It is no more evident than on their already critically acclaimed debut "School Was My Hustle."
